Tigers to Face No. 51 Oklahoma State in First Round of Big 12 Women's Tennis Championship

April 25, 2006

Columbia, Mo. - The University of Missouri women's tennis team will begin play in the 2006 Big 12 Women's Tennis Championship on Thursday against No. 51 Oklahoma State. The match is scheduled to start at noon on the campus of Baylor University in Waco, Texas. Live stats for the match will be available on Baylor's official Web site, www.baylorbears.com.

Missouri (10-11, 1-10 Big 12) is coming off two road losses to end the regular season. They are the 11th seed in the Championships. Saturday, the Tigers lost to then-No 19 Texas, 7-0. Sunday, they fell to then-No. 39 Texas A&M, 7-0.

The Cowgirls (13-9, 6-5 Big 12) have earned the sixth seed after a tiebreak between Kansas State and Nebraska. The three teams were tied for fifth place in the conference at 6-5, but the Cornhuskers got the fifth seed after comparing the three teams by their performance against the top teams in the conference.

The winner of the Thursday's first round match will advance to the quarterfinals to play the 20th-ranked Texas Longhorns, the third seed, at 11 a.m. on Friday.

Tiger Notes

Last Meeting Between the Two Teams In their only meeting this season, April 2, the then-No. 65 Cowgirls defeated Missouri, 5-2. In the match, the Tigers got singles wins from Yelena Olshanskaya at No. 1, and Amanda Pratzel at No. 5. At No. 2, Missouri's Lubica Nadasska lost her match in three sets, 3-6, 6-4, 6-3, to OSU's Lauren Simmons. At No. 4, Erika Josbena also lost a three set match. Tigers' Val Dandik and Chrissy Svetlic fell in their matches at No. 3 and No. 6 respectively. In doubles action, the Tigers got a win at No. 2 doubles, as the duo of Pratzel and Erika Josbena teamed up to win their match, 8-3. Despite winning the No. 2 doubles match, the Tigers lost the doubles point after falling in the No. 1 and No. 3 matches. At No. 1, the Oklahoma State duo of Masnic and Yawna Allen defeated Olshanskaya and Pratzel 8-4. And at No. 3, the Missouri duo of Dandik and Nadasska fell to OSU's Tsivka and Osinska 8-6.

Tigers All-Time in the Big 12 Championship Missouri is 3-9 in 12 matches in the Big 12 Women's Tennis Championship. Last season the Tigers defeated Oklahoma State in the first round before falling to Baylor in the second round.

Tigers and Cowgirls Meet for the 5th Time in Big 12 Championship History The meeting between Missouri and Oklahoma State will be a repeat of last season's first round match. It also marks the fifth time the Tigers and Cowgirls will meet in the history of the Big 12 Championships. In their first four matches against each other, the Cowgirls lead, 3-1.

Update on Pratzel's Winning Percentage After her two losses last weekend, Tiger junior Amanda Pratzel's singles record dropped to 15-6. The mark gives her a .714 winning percentage, tying her with senior Hana Kraftova for seventh in Missouri history. Kraftova finished the 2002-03 season with a 15-6 mark. If Pratzel wins her match against Oklahoma State, and the Tigers lose, she will be tied for sixth with teammate Charlotte Bellis, who went 16-6 last season.

Tigers Move Up Career Singles Wins Leader Board With 13 singles victories on the 2005-06 season, Tiger junior Yelena Olshanskaya has moved into eighth place in Mizzou's career singles wins leader board. Olshanskaya's current career record stands at 59-45. Tiger senior Hana Kraftova is right behind Olshanskaya in ninth place all-time. Kraftova's career record is 53-51, after an injury-shortened season in which she earned six victories.

In Doubles Action... With a 9-5 record in doubles action this season, Tiger senior Hana Kraftova has moved into sixth place all time at Missouri in career doubles wins with a record of 60-32. She moved up from ninth at the beginning of the season. Tiger junior Erika Josbena is currently tied for tenth place with a record of 48-53.

Two Tigers Selected to Big 12 10th Anniversary Team The Missouri doubles team of Katka Sevcikova and Urska Juric were selected to the Big 12 Conference women's 10th Anniversary Team. The duo made the All Big 12 first team in 2002, 2003 and 2004. In the 2001-02 season, they went 37-8, to give them a .822 winning percentage. The percentage made the duo the most successful doubles team in Missouri women's tennis history. Sevcikova and Juric also won both the 2001 and 2002 ITA Central Region Indoor Doubles Championship. In 2003, they qualified for the NCAA Doubles Tournament. A photo gallery of both men's and women's 10th Anniversary Team members can be found on the official Big 12 Web site, www.big12sports.com.
